Closed Bug 929407 Opened 7 years ago Closed 7 years ago

Define System's Inter-App Communication API exposed to FTU and Settings for FxA flow

Categories

(Firefox OS Graveyard :: Gaia::System, defect)

All
Gonk (Firefox OS)
defect
Not set
normal

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: spenrose, Assigned: arcturus)

References

Details

(Whiteboard: [qa-])

Attachments

(2 files, 5 obsolete files)

FTU (897600) and Settings (905637) need to trigger FxA UX flows which will run in the context of the System App. Define the IAC calls used.
Blocks: 929388
Whiteboard: [qa-]
Attached patch WIP_3.spenrose.patch (obsolete) — Splinter Review
Add test for signIn and teardown for the sinon stub, rolling in previous from fjordan.
Attachment #820870 - Attachment is obsolete: true
Attachment #820891 - Attachment is obsolete: true
Attached patch WIP_4.spenrose.patch (obsolete) — Splinter Review
Tweak to last test; rolls up previous work.
Attachment #820911 - Attachment is obsolete: true
This patch includes the icons (binaries), apply with --binary
Attachment #820943 - Attachment is obsolete: true
Remember to apply as binary :)
This is now part of the parent:

  https://bugzilla.mozilla.org/show_bug.cgi?id=929388

specifically attachment "IAC and Client APIs":

  https://bug929388.bugzilla.mozilla.org/attachment.cgi?id=824022
Status: NEW → RESOLVED
Closed: 7 years ago
Resolution: --- → FIXED
Assignee: nobody → francisco.jordano
You need to log in before you can comment on or make changes to this bug.